Can You Meet the Prerequisites for LVN Programs?

Practical nursing program requirements will range from one school to the next but will probably have some common conditions. You’ll need to be the minimum legal age, already have earned a high school diploma or equivalent, successfully pass a background screening and then you must test negative for any drugs.

Before you sign a commitment with the practical nursing program you have chosen, it is strongly suggested that you take the time to look at the accreditation status of the classes with the Texas State Board. Although they are not as vital as accreditation, you should evaluate a few of the following parts also:

  • Job placement programs
  • Just how well do trainees do taking the license evaluation
  • Qualifications of trainers
